COMMERCE CITY, Colo. - Alan Gordon scored in the 69th minute, Robbie Keane added a goal in stoppage time and the Los Angeles Galaxy ended a 15-match winless streak on the road with a 3-1 victory over the Colorado Rapids on Saturday night.

Sebastian Lletget tied it in the 56th minute to start the Galaxy (10-7-7) on their way to their first road win since a 4-3 decision at Colorado last Aug. 20.

Marcelo Sarvas scored his first goal for the Rapids (5-7-9), who had a three-game winning streak snapped, in the 12th minute against his former team. He beat goalie Donovan Ricketts to the ball, tapped it to his left and knocked it into a wide open goal.

Ricketts, acquired in a trade with Orlando City two days earlier, played in L.A. for three seasons and was named Goalkeeper of the Year in 2010.
